Sensys Gatso receives five-year contract extension in Albany, New York worth SEK 21.5 million
Sensys Gatso Group, a global leader in traffic safety solutions, has through its subsidiary Sensys Gatso USA, signed a five-year contract extension for Managed Services with the city of Albany, the State Capitol of New York. The automated red light camera enforcement program, which originally went into effect in 2015, will continue for five more years and has an approximate annual revenue value of $470K USD, corresponding to a total contract value of approximately $2.4M or SEK 21.5 million over the 5 year period.

Sensys Gatso Australia receives order for maintenance services worth SEK 12 million
Sensys Gatso Group, a global leader in traffic safety solutions, through its subsidiary Sensys Gatso Australia, has received an order worth AUD 1.8 million, corresponding to SEK 12 million for the provision of maintenance support services for mobile camera systems over the next 6 years to Serco Traffic Camera Services on behalf of the Victorian Government. It is expected that additional systems will be added to the scope leading to the total contract value of annuity services of up to AUD 11.3 million, corresponding to SEK 75 million over 6 years.

Sensys Gatso USA and Town of Upper Marlboro, US, have mutually agreed to terminate the contract
Sensys Gatso Group, a global leader in traffic safety solutions, announced on May 28th 2018, through its subsidiary Sensys Gatso USA, a purchase order worth SEK 9 million to provide a speed and red light photo enforcement program to the town of Upper Marlboro, Maryland, USA. Subject to mutual agreement, the Town of Upper Marlboro and Sensys Gatso USA have agreed to terminate the contract for a managed services enforcement program with immediate effect. The program was not started yet.

Sensys Gatso delivers third batch in-vehicle enforcement systems to Saudi Arabia
Sensys Gatso Group, a global leader in traffic safety solutions, announced on March 22nd, 2018, a procurement award for in-vehicle based traffic enforcement systems from a governmental customer in Saudi Arabia. The procurement award concerned the delivery of systems to a potential total value of EUR 10 million, corresponding to SEK 100 million. Under the procurement award the customer has placed a first order of SEK 66 million (press release September 24, 2018).
